Game Recap: Men's Basketball |

Perimeter Shooting from Oshkosh downs Blue Devils, 83-72

The Basics
Score: UW-Stout 72, (RV) UW-Oshkosh 83
Record: Blue Devils (4-13, 1-7), Titans (14-5, 7-1)
Location: Johnson Fieldhouse - Menomonie, Wis. 
Date: Jan. 23, 2023

After a very slow start the game, with both teams starting out one for seven from the floor, Oshkosh put together a little run to get themselves up 24-9. Stout battled back, closing it within 10 points multiple times, but a three-point barrage by the Titans kept the lead in their favor, moving on to the 83-72 win.

Top Performers 
  • Jacob Walczak led the Blue Devils with 13 points with three threes on the night.
  • Four other Blue Devils hit double digit scoring: George Scharlau (12), Jackson Noll (12), Carson Moe (10), and Cooper Diedrich (10)
  • Hunter Plamann led the Titans with 24 making five threes. Borchert (17), Steckbauer (16), Mahoney (12) added in points for the Titans as well.
Inside the Box Score  
  • Blue Devils shot 22 for 59 from the floor with 5 for 18 threes, the Blue Devils made the most of their trips to the charity stripe, cashing in on 21 of 23 shots.
  • Oshkosh made 25 of their 54 shots and shot 50% from deep (12 for 24).
  • Oshkosh won the battle on the glass with 38 rebounds compared to Stout's 31.
